How we work

From form submission to your first working workflow.

Scoper sells a structured starter kit, not a build service. We do not write your code, sit in your meetings, or take ongoing responsibility for your workflows. What we sell is the structured starting point — the prompts, the scaffolding, and the evaluation criteria — so you can build confidently with Claude or ChatGPT yourself.

Submitting the intake form is how you get the kit. We check your workflow against our archetype library and, if we have a match, your kit arrives within 24 hours. From there, the build is yours.

We are explicit about what is included and what is not. The kit is a starting point, not a finished system. It is designed so that someone willing to spend 1–2 hours in a Claude environment can get visible output on day one.
